What it is, How it works

Hair analysis has emerged as an effective mechanism for identifying drug and alcohol consumption. Hair retains long-term history of alcohol and drugs by embedding biomarkers within the strands of the growing hair. When collected near the scalp, hair can offer a detection window of up to around 3 months for alcohol and drug use. Hair is straightforward to collect, relatively hard to tamper with, and convenient to transport.

A 1.5-inch section containing approximately 200 hair strands (similar to a #2 pencil) near the scalp will provide 100mg of hair, which is the optimal amount for screening and confirmation. For EtG, additional tests, and/or panels over 10, 150mg of the specimen is suggested. It's advised to weigh the sample on a jeweler’s scale. If scalp hair is unavailable, a similar quantity of body hair may be gathered. When mentioning head hair, it's specifically scalp hair. Body hair encompasses all other types (facial, axillary, etc.).

Process Overview

The primary steps in lab processing of a drug test result are Accessioning, Screening, Extraction, and Confirmation.

Accessioning entails the initial handling of a sample into a lab's system. It incorporates ensuring the sample was properly sealed and dispatched, assigning a unique LAN (Laboratory Accessioning Number), and completing any extra data entry not provided by an electronic chain of custody system.

Screening comprises an initial rapid assessment for substances of abuse. Although Screening is an affordable method to rule out drug use in most samples, a positive result must be confirmed for court admissibility. Samples with presumptive positive results in Screening require further confirmation.

If Screening indicates a presumptive positive result, additional hair is taken from the original sample and prepared for Extraction. In this phase, drugs are extracted from hair at significantly lower concentrations than other techniques (e.g., urine or oral fluid), which is why hair drug analysis is considered the most challenging method.

Any positive result identified during Screening undergoes Confirmation via GC/MS, GC/MS/MS or LC/MS/MS. All presumed positive samples are washed before confirmation if necessary. The entire lab process from Accessioning to Confirmation is reviewed under the CAP (College of American Pathologists) Hair designation and conforms to ISO / IEC 17025 standards.

Advantages of hair drug testing:

  • Extended detection window: Hair drug tests can reveal drug use for a period of up to 90 days, compared to urine tests which cover a shorter timeframe.
  • Challenge to adulterate: Hair drug tests are highly secure and resistant to tampering, enhancing result accuracy.
  • Offers historical insight: It can demonstrate a pattern of drug use over an extended period, beyond recent activities.

Limitations:

  • Inability to detect recent consumption: Drugs require 5-7 days to be traceable in hair.
  • Expense: Hair drug tests are typically pricier than other testing methods.
  • Result variability: Factors such as hair color and growth rate can influence metabolite concentration in the hair.

Note: Although commonly termed as "hair follicle tests", the assessment evaluates the hair strand, not the follicle beneath the scalp
